Barytes from Chirbury

Abstract

I AM indebted to Mr. Yelland of Wotherton for sending me some fine examples of the crystals described by Mr. Miers in NATURE, vol xxix. p. 29, and am collecting several particulars respecting their occurrence. Some time ago I commenced a determination of the faces, but my work has been interrupted.
